Remember when Samsung Care was all about keeping your precious smartphone safe and sound? Well, it seems the tech giant, ever attentive to our everyday lives, has decided to broaden its horizons—and frankly, our peace of mind. They’ve just rolled out an expansive new chapter for Samsung Care, extending its robust warranty plans to cover something equally vital: our home appliances. Yes, you heard that right.

This is precisely where Samsung is stepping in. Their expanded Samsung Care program now offers comprehensive extended warranty options tailored specifically for home appliances. It's a move that genuinely underscores their commitment to customer satisfaction, going beyond the initial sale to ensure long-term reliability and support. It means that whether it’s your spiffy new QLED TV, that gleaming French door fridge, or even your super-efficient dishwasher, you can now opt for an extra layer of protection.
